Stable product with a valuable combination of structured text and databases
What is our primary use case?
What is most valuable?
The application's most valuable feature is the combination of structured text and databases.
What needs improvement?
It is complicated to connect Notion with external systems. We have to transfer the data or convert files into compatible formats for generating final reports.
They should include a feature for queries within text documents, including snippets of databases and formulas.
For how long have I used the solution?
We have been using Notion for two years now.
What do I think about the stability of the solution?
It is a stable product. However, it works slowly for reloading large databases.
Which solution did I use previously and why did I switch?
I use EverNote and OneNote. Both platforms don't have a concept of structured databases similar to Notion.
How was the initial setup?
The initial setup is easy.
What's my experience with pricing, setup cost, and licensing?
The product's pricing depends on the usage plans. Currently, they offer a free plan for individual users with some limitations. I also have access to its educational plan, which is a bit more expensive. There are different plans with free versions. Further, we can subscribe to the paid versions depending on the use cases.
What other advice do I have?
There are plenty of products like Notion. For individual users, I recommend it because of the accessibility of the features. At the same time, I advise large organizations to compare a few different systems before making a purchase decision.
I rate Notion a nine out of ten.

Versatile productivity tool that requires commitment and a learning curve
What is our primary use case?
I primarily use it for managing tasks and collaborating with colleagues. When I encounter an issue or have a task to complete, I create a ticket and provide solutions. I also use Notion to schedule my work and coding tasks since it's a versatile tool that helps me stay organized. For instance, when I encounter hiccups in the morning, I can simply refer to my Notion workspace to see what tasks need to be addressed and then review them at the end of the day. Its flexibility allows me to customize the design to my liking, making it user-friendly.
How has it helped my organization?
My team often works remotely and Notion has become an integral part of our workflow, and it has greatly improved our productivity. We use it not only for providing services to our clients but also for keeping ourselves organized and on track with our daily tasks. This dual purpose has proven to be a valuable experience for us, both in terms of monitoring our progress and ensuring that we stay on top of our daily responsibilities.
What is most valuable?
I find the table feature in Notion to be incredibly valuable as it allows me to organize and manage data efficiently. The ability to structure data is one of the most essential functions of Notion. Also, the capability to link data between different parts of the business is a standout feature.
What needs improvement?
It would be great if Notion introduced a feature like network logs or simply expanded its color palette. Currently, the available color choices are somewhat limited, and I often receive requests from people for specific colors that are not available. Adding more color options to the application would enhance its usability and flexibility, allowing users to better customize their content.
For how long have I used the solution?
I have been using Notion for around five months now.
What do I think about the stability of the solution?
It provides excellent stability capabilities.
What do I think about the scalability of the solution?
It has proven to be highly scalable and capable of accommodating thousands of contacts and extensive data without any issues.
Which solution did I use previously and why did I switch?
I have experience using both Asana and Notion and when it comes to choosing between the two, I find myself leaning more towards Notion. While Asana is undoubtedly a good tool, I have some reservations about its design and interface. Notion, on the other hand, has a great design and interface. Asana is effective for task management, but I didn't connect with it as much, since I didn't use it extensively. My experience with Notion has been different and I quickly grasped its capabilities and enjoyed the learning process. It encourages a more technical approach with features like formulas and the ability to create customized databases, which I appreciate. It allows users to bring their ideas to life without being limited by pre-defined structures.
What's my experience with pricing, setup cost, and licensing?
The pricing structure is quite reasonable, and the basic plan covers the most essential features. It is ideal for those who simply need to create and manage tasks or to-do lists.
What other advice do I have?
For companies considering adopting Notion as their organizational tool, I would recommend taking the time to thoroughly evaluate it, alongside other options like Asana. Different companies have varying levels of patience when it comes to learning and implementing new features, and Notion's extensive capabilities might make some hesitant. It requires an investment of time and effort because it offers a high degree of technical flexibility, akin to coding in some aspects. Therefore, if your organization is looking for a quick and simple solution to manage databases and CRMs, you might want to explore other product management platforms. If your company is willing to invest the time and effort into learning and implementing Notion effectively, it can greatly enhance productivity as it allows you to create a customized and user-friendly interface, tailored to your specific needs. I would rate it seven out of ten.
